On Tue, 7 Nov 2000 15:38:21 -0500, wlipford@tnsi.com wrote:
> I am trying to invoke a Make after i run the config.sh will no problems, i
> have followed the right procedures to use ARS perl, and have static linked
> ARS when prompted, attached is the screen shot i recieve, i am using the
> newest version of perl, Hpux 11.0, and using gcc as a compliler.
>  <<HOSTEX (3).SAV>> 

ARS               Mmhh Interface to Remedy's Action Request API     JMURPHY

Since above module is not in the core distribution, it's probably better to
contact the author/maintainer of this module. It's not very likely that p5p
members have this module installed and are able to test what went wrong.

First build perl from your distribution (using no external modules) and than
*add* this ARS module afterwards. The log you sent indicates that you tried to
embed this module in the core distribution.
